Here’s a list of different ways to create your DIY makeup remover:

  1. Coconut Oil and Olive Oil Makeup Remover

Coconut and olive oil are the two key components of this DIY makeup remover. Coconut oil acts as an antibacterial agent while olive oil moisturizes the skin. This combination of natural oils will remove even the most stubborn of makeup without stripping off the natural oils from your skin.

To make this at home, you’ll need to mix equal amounts of coconut and olive oil in a container. Use a cotton pad or a reusable cloth to apply the mixture onto your face, gently wiping off your makeup. Rinse your face with lukewarm water and pat dry.

  1. Witch Hazel and Almond Oil Makeup Remover

Almond oil is a great natural ingredient in removing makeup and effectively cleaning the skin. Witch hazel, on the other hand, acts as an astringent which helps unclog pores and soothes the skin.

Combine 2 tablespoons of witch hazel and 1 tablespoon of almond oil in a container. Soak a cotton ball in the mixture and gently wipe off your makeup. Rinse with lukewarm water and pat dry.

  1. Aloe Vera and Jojoba Oil Makeup Remover

Aloe Vera is well-known for its hydrating and soothing properties, making it an excellent option for a makeup remover. Jojoba oil is also hydrating and incredibly effective in removing makeup and dirt from deep within pores.

Mix 1 tablespoon of aloe vera gel with 1 tablespoon of jojoba oil in a container. Apply the mixture onto your face with a cotton pad or reusable cloth, gently wiping off your makeup. Rinse your face with lukewarm water and pat dry.

Tips and advice:

  • Always use a clean cotton pad or washcloth to remove your makeup. This will help to prevent the spread of bacteria and avoid any unwanted breakouts.

  • If you have sensitive skin, it’s best to avoid using ingredients like lemon juice or apple cider vinegar. These can be harsh on the skin and cause irritation.

  • If you’re using oil-based removers like coconut oil or olive oil, it’s important to double cleanse your skin to ensure that all the oil is removed.

  • Be gentle when applying and removing your DIY makeup remover. Harsh rubbing can damage your skin and cause redness and irritation.

  • Experiment with different ingredients and find the perfect formula for your skin type. Everyone’s skin is different, so it’s important to find what works best for you.
